Vintage Date On A Wine Label Means. When there is a date on a bottle of wine, it is universally a vintage date, referring to the year the grapes were picked. But why does that matter? In wine, the vintage can tell you a lot about what’s inside the bottle. A wine vintage refers to the year in which the grapes used to make the wine were harvested.
